Ennis posts a total current liabilities of $41M as of May 2026. That compares with $46M in the prior-year period — down 11.2% year over year. Comparing that reading with peers and prior periods is usually more useful than looking at the number in isolation.

In the prior comparable period, Ennis's total current liabilities was $46M. The latest reading is $41M — a 11.2% year-over-year decrease (period ending May 2026). Use the history and growth charts on this page for a longer lookback.
